BM-13 (Chevrolet G-7107) Rocket Launcher "Katyusha"

Based on the US Chevrolet G-7107 chassis, the BM-13 was another mounts of the infamous Katyusha rocket launchers (or "Stalin's Organs"). The M-13 was also mounted on other vehicles.

Close